i have created a code such that data is appended to csv file every time the loop runs
but when i run the program again the new data is added with the old one
but i want to clear out the data in then csvfile before hand
what command do i use
delete('xyz.csv') deletes the whole file

fclose(fopen('xyz.csv', 'w'));
When you open a file for writing with 'w' access, the existing content is discarded.
Note: the POSIX standard library specifies truncate() and ftruncate() functions that would be a closer match. However, MATLAB does not implement either of those.
